Java жадының қандай түрлері бар?
Java жадының қандай түрлері бар?

Бейне: Java жадының қандай түрлері бар?

Бейне: Java жадының қандай түрлері бар?
Бейне: Java Tech Talk: 1 сағат үшін java туралы жеделхат бот 2024, Мамыр
Anonim

The жады ішінде JVM беске бөлінеді әртүрлі бөліктер, атап айтқанда− Әдіс аймағы− Әдіс аймағы класс кодын сақтайды: айнымалылар мен әдістердің коды. Үйме – The Java объектілері осы аумақта құрылған. Java Стек – әдістерді іске қосу кезінде нәтижелер стекте сақталады жады.

Осыны ескере отырып, JVM-де қанша естелік түрі бар?

The жады ішінде JVM 5-ке бөлінеді әртүрлі бөліктері:

Үйме. Стек. Бағдарламаның есептегіш тізілімі. Жергілікті әдіс стек.

JVM операцияның белгілі бір түрлерін орындайды:

  • Код жүктелуде.
  • Кодты тексеру.
  • Кодты орындау.
  • Ол пайдаланушыларға жұмыс уақыты ортасын қамтамасыз етеді.

Жоғарыда көрсетілгеннен басқа, Java тіліндегі негізгі жады дегеніміз не? Біріншіден, « негізгі жады «біз» дегенді білдіреміз Java JVM' арқылы көрінетін үйме. JVM әдетте айнымалының жергілікті көшірмесімен жұмыс істеуге тегін. Мысалы, JIT компиляторы a мәнін жүктейтін кодты жасай алады Java айнымалыны регистрге айналдырады, содан кейін сол регистрде жұмыс істейді.

Демек, үйме жадының қандай түрлері бар?

3 Жауаптар. Үйме Жас ұрпақ, ескі немесе тұрақты ұрпақ және тұрақты ұрпақ болып бөлінеді. Жас ұрпақ - бұл барлық жаңа нысандар бөлінген және ескірген.

JVM дегеніміз не және маған Java жадын бөлуді түсіндіріңіз бе?

The JVM кодты жүктейді, кодты тексереді, кодты орындайды, басқарады жады (оған кіреді жадты бөлу Операциялық жүйеден (ОЖ), басқару Java бөлу үйінді тығыздау мен қоқыс нысандарын жоюды қоса) және соңында орындалу ортасын қамтамасыз етеді.

Ұсынылған: